Description
Delightful cookies that are soft, chewy, and filled with semi-sweet chocolate chips, perfect for cozy winter evenings.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 tsp baking soda
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 3/4 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1 large egg
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, and salt.
- In a larger bowl, cream together but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ar.
- Beat in the egg and vanilla extract until well combined.
- Gradually mix in the flour mixture until combined without overmixing.
- Fold in the chocolate chips gently.
- Drop dough onto a baking sheet and bake for 10-12 minutes until edges are lightly golden.
- Cool on baking sheet for a few minutes, then transfer to a wire rack.
Notes
Chill the dough for 30 minutes for thicker cookies; do not overmix to ensure chewiness.
